Self-cleaning flow regulating table
Technical Field
The utility model relates to the technical field of flow regulation, in particular to a self-cleaning flow regulation table.
Background
Epidemiological investigation (abbreviated as "flow modulation") refers to investigation by epidemiological methods, and is mainly used to study the distribution of diseases, health and hygiene events and their determinants.
When people outside the country need to enter the country, the people can be subjected to flow regulation after reaching the designated position, and the flow regulation platform is mainly used for auditing and epidemiological investigation and medical inspection of health declaration of the entering passengers, and when the flow regulation is carried out, the number of people is more, and certificates need to be placed on equipment, if the passengers carry infectious epidemic, the certificates can be caused to carry bacteria to remain on the equipment, so that the next passengers can be infected, and in order to avoid the cross infection, the self-cleaning flow regulation platform is provided.

The working principle of the embodiment is as follows:
when a passenger needs to flow the paper, the passenger inserts the certificate into the clamp 36 through the clamp hole 31, then the motor 32 drives the rotary table 33 to rotate, the rotary table 33 drives the convex rod 34 to rotate, the convex rod 34 rotates to enable the movable rod 35 to move backwards, the movable rod 35 drives the clamp 36 to move backwards, the clamp 36 drives the certificate to move backwards, the controller 41 starts to convey alcohol in the alcohol tank 4 to the water outlet pipe 43 through the water inlet pipe 42, then sprays the alcohol into the equipment tank 3 through the atomizing nozzle 44 and sprays the alcohol on the surface of the cleaning rod 39, the clamp 36 drives the certificate to move backwards to clean and disinfect the surface of the certificate through the gap between the cleaning rods 39, when the certificate moves to the upper part of the sensor 310, the information and other conditions of the passenger can be inquired, meanwhile, the ultraviolet sterilizer 311 performs ultraviolet sterilization on the certificate and the inside of the device box 3, so that other passengers with bacteria in the certificate are prevented from remaining in the device, after the inspection is finished, the turntable 33 rotates to enable the movable rod 35 to move forward through the convex rod 34 to push out the certificate, if the passenger meets the entrance standard, the indicator lamp 5 can light a green light, the flashboard 6 rotates backwards to open a channel, and if the passenger does not reach the entrance standard, the indicator lamp 5 lights a red light, and the flashboard 6 cannot rotate so that the passenger cannot advance to wait for the arrangement of staff in situ.
